I have an Acer and got it maybe a year ago or so for emergency backup. A lot of people use internet on their phones which are really wee tiny things so I don't quite understand the balking about the netbook screen. It's massive compared to a PDA or a phone.
The netbook's performance has been just fine, it's quick to load on a high speed connection. It doesn't have a CD rom drive or DVD drive so bear that in mind when thinking about installing software.
The screen is too small for certain sites and situations so depending on the job you do it could be either perfect or inappropriate.
